Latest Patents
One of Gaykowski's latest patents is focused on methods and systems for a wireless monitoring system for a tank. This innovation pertains to a system and method related to a wireless remote monitoring system that is incorporated into or coupled to a lid for the tank. The wireless monitoring system can include a cover system that features a lid mountable on a corresponding tank. The lid is designed with a space sized and shaped for receiving the wireless remote monitoring system, which is operatively coupled to a sensor.
